Job Title: Specialist Occupational Therapist Location: Newry, Northern Ireland Contract Type: Temporary / Fixed-Term Salary: Competitive Rates to be discussed Role Overview We are currently seeking an experienced Specialist Occupational Therapist to join a specialist palliative care service in Newry. This role involves providing high-quality occupational therapy to patients with complex palliative care needs, working as part of a multidisciplinary team to support independence, comfort and quality of life. Key Requirements * Minimum 3 years’ post-graduate Occupational Therapy experience * Experience working within a multidisciplinary team * Experience providing Occupational Therapy interventions to palliative care patients in an acute and/or community setting * Registered with the HCPC * Diploma or Degree in Occupational Therapy recognised by WFOT * Experience in postural management and prescription of specialised seating systems * Experience assessing and recommending adaptive equipment * Excellent communication, organisational and prioritisation skills * Ability to work independently and effectively within a multidisciplinary team * Full UK driving licence and access to a car for work purposes, including appropriate business insurance, or another suitable arrangement Desirable Experience * Experience in fatigue, anxiety and dyspnoea management * Knowledge of current oncology and palliative care guidelines * Experience facilitating group activities * Experience participating in audit or research * Experience using cognitive screening tools * Postgraduate development in palliative care or a related specialist area * Knowledge and understanding of RQIA standards What We Offer * Temporary / fixed-term opportunity * Band 6 equivalent role * Monday to Friday working pattern * 22.5–31 hours per week * Opportunity to work within a specialist palliative care multidisciplinary team * Opportunity to contribute to clinical governance and service development * Personalised support from our recruitment team * Opportunity to develop specialist clinical experience within a patient-centred environment About Us Oxford Natural Healthcare Professionals is a trusted provider of clinical talent to the UK’s private healthcare sector.
